What is a Non-Electric Walking Pad?
A non-electric walking pad is a by hand operated treadmill that needs no source of power besides the force generated by the user's motion. These gadgets are designed to accommodate walking and jogging, making them appropriate for both light exercises and more intense workouts-- while getting rid of the necessity for electricity.

Non-electric walking pads come with an array of advantages that make them a desirable choice for lots of fitness lovers. Here are some of the primary benefits:
1. Eco-Friendly
Among the most compelling factors to select a non-electric walking pad is that it requires no electricity. In a period where environmental effect is a major issue, using less energy contributes to sustainability.
2. Affordable
Non-electric walking pads are typically cheaper to make and acquire than their electric counterparts. They also eliminate continuous electricity costs. For users searching for a cost effective way to remain fit at home, this is a considerable advantage.
3. Improved Stability and Safety
Because non-electric walking pads usually have a lower speed, users have greater control over their pace. This makes them safer for those who may fight with balance or coordination, such as the senior.
4. Low Maintenance
Manual Treadmill Price walking pads need minimal maintenance compared to electric models, which may need routine servicing and occasional part replacements. This reliability can be a plus for hectic individuals.
5. Versatile Workouts
Many models use adjustable inclines that enable users to improve their workouts. This feature suggests that anybody can tailor their exercise routine to meet their specific objectives, whether it's weight reduction or endurance training.

Regularly Asked Questions1. Are non-electric walking pads easy to utilize?
Yes, they are uncomplicated to run-- you simply step onto the pad and begin walking! The motion of walking generates the motion.
2. What is the weight limitation for non-electric walking pads?
Weight limits vary by model, normally varying from 200 to 350 pounds. Constantly check the specifications before buying.
3. Is it suitable for people of all ages?
Typically, yes-- it is more secure for older adults due to its lower speed. However, just like any exercise program, people must speak with a doctor before starting.
4. How does a non-electric walking pad compare to a standard Self Powered Treadmill?
Although both serve similar purposes, non-electric walking pads are more affordable, quieter, and energy-efficient. Conventional treadmills offer innovative functions like digital display screens and preset workout programs but included higher costs and upkeep.
5. Can you work on a non-electric walking pad?
Yes, many designs permit light running along with walking. Nevertheless, the experience may vary from electric treadmills, as users need to produce their motion.
